A therapeutic class for beginners and those looking to heal from an injury.
A class that uses the great wall rope system and conscious breathwork to anchor the practice. Practice asanas with the security of the wall rope and remain in postures for longer, promoting traction and releasing tension in the spine, major joints and muscle groups. When sequenced well, it is highly effective in creating space in the spine, relieving back pain and nerve compression.

A prop based class to calm your nerves
Gentle, slow-paced and passive designed to promote deep relaxation, reduce stress and heal by resting in supported postures for extended periods of time (5-20 minutes). Utilises props like bolsters, blankets, blocks to fully support the body in postures to activate the body’s parasympathetic nervous system and induce rest. Regular practice stimulates production of happy hormones cortisol, helps alleviates worry and overcome difficult emotions. Suitable for all levels of practitioner.

An expressive and dynamic yoga class
An athletic style of yoga that syncs your breath with movement, allowing you to flow continuously from one pose to the next rather than holding positions statically. Emphasises a smooth, dance like rhythm designed to build strength, flexibility and a focused state. It enhances cardiovascular health, increases flexibility and strengthens muscles and joints. Suitable for all levels of practitioner.
